Immunogen :
This Pax-2 antibody was generated against a recombinant protein containing 22kD of the Pax-2 sequence corresponding to amino acids 188-385.
Application Notes :
This antibody is effective in immunoblotting (WB), immunohistochemistry (IHC), immunopurification and DNA band supershift experiments.*Predicted MW = 44 kDPositive Control Tissue: normal kidney or renal adenocarcinomaThis antibody recognizes Pax-2A and Pax-2B (two products of the Pax-2 gene). When linked to agarose beads, it has been used to immunoprecipitate DNA sequences recognized by Pax-2.;This product may contain other non-IgG subtypes.;
